Can't download a text message

I get a message and it says to "Tap to", I tap it, it moves a little and then nothing happens. This has happened with 3 texts, I know 2 of the 3 are iPhones. The other significant thing is my phone upgraded to Android 9 yesterday and this is the first time I've had a problem receiving from these people.
 
Are you using the stock Android Messages app for messaging or something else? Also, what carrier are you using, and does it matter if you're connected to Wi-Fi or mobile data?
 
If this is only MMS then check your APN (access point names) settings. Many service providers use different APNs for MMS and data, so if the APN for MMS is wrong then it can produce exactly this problem.

You should be able to find your service provider's APN settings from their website (otherwise a web search will quickly find them).
